i-Fusion FCC Regulations
FCC Declaration of Conformity Statement
This device complies with Part 15 of the FCC Rules. Operation is
subject to the following two conditions: (1) this device may not cause
harmful interference, and (2) this device must accept any interference
received, including interference that may cause undesired operation.
Radio and Television Interference
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its
for a Class B digital device, p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ules. These
lim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ful
inter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ates, uses,
and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in
acc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io
commun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will
not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ause
inter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by
turning the equipment off and then on, the user is encouraged to try to
correct the interference by one or more of the following measures:
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ver.
Connect the equipment to a different outlet so that the equipment
and receiver are on different branch circuits.
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
Changes or modifications not expressly approved by Sonic Impact could
void the users authority to operate the equipment.

    Why is there no sound from my Sonic Impact Technologies Docking Station speakers?
    • M
      millermarkJul 31, 2025
      If you are experiencing no sound from the speakers of your Sonic Impact Technologies Docking Station, several factors could be the cause. First, ensure the universal power supply cord is correctly plugged into both the wall outlet and the AC input jack on the side of the i-Fusion system. Second, check that the volume isn't set too low; press the “+” button to increase it. If you're using an iPod, remove it and firmly re-seat it in the docking station. If you're not using the docking station, verify the 3.5mm stereo cable is connected to your audio source, ensuring it's fully inserted into the correct jacks, specifically the “line-out”, “audio out”, or the headphone jack on your sound card or other audio source.

    How to fix Sonic Impact Technologies Docking Station when power LED is not lit?
    • J
      Jeanne SmithAug 5, 2025
      If the power LED on your Sonic Impact Technologies Docking Station isn't lighting up when the AC adapter is plugged in, try the following: First, make sure the power switch is in the “on” position. Next, check that the universal power supply cord is properly connected to a functioning wall outlet and that the power supply connector is securely plugged into the jack on the back of the i-Fusion system. If you're using a surge protector, ensure it's switched on. Finally, test the wall outlet by plugging in another device to confirm it's working.

    Why is my Sonic Impact Technologies Docking Station making a crackling sound?
    • H
      Heidi BlevinsAug 11, 2025
      If you're hearing a crackling sound from the speakers of your Sonic Impact Technologies Docking Station, it might be due to a bad connection or an issue with your audio source. First, ensure your iPod is correctly seated in the docking station. If you're using a 3.5mm stereo cable, check its connection, making sure it's connected to the “Line out”, “audio out”, or the headphone jack on your sound card or audio source, and not the “speaker-out”. To rule out a problem with your original audio source, unplug the 3.5mm stereo cable and plug it into the headphone jack of an alternate source like a Walkman, Discman, or FM radio.

    What to do if clips securing hinge straps are releasing on Sonic Impact Technologies Docking Station?
    • K
      Kristen FranklinAug 25, 2025
      If the clips securing the hinge straps on your Sonic Impact Technologies Docking Station are releasing, the tension of the release button likely needs adjustment. Insert the tip of a ballpoint pen through the hole in the back of the clip and push in. This will tighten the tension on the release button.
